ADMISSION INFO

A 20% Buyer's Premium will be charged on all purchases. The Buyer's Premium is in addition to your high bid if you are the successful high bidder. For example, if you bid $100.00 at an auction with a 20% Buyer's Premium, and you are the successful high bidder, you will be invoiced $120.00 (Your $100.00 Bid + $20.00 for the Buyer's Premium). Please bid accordingly. There is never a fee to place a bid and no Buyer's Premium is charged unless you are the successful high bidder for a lot or lots at the auction, and are therefore the purchaser of the item(s).
